Left Front Side of the Engine Components (L96 or LC8)

Items
1. Q38 Throttle Body Q38 Throttle Body (L96/LC8/LV1)
2. B74 Manifold Absolute Pressure Sensor B74 Manifold Absolute Pressure Sensor (L96/LC8)
3. Q12 Evaporative Emission Purge Solenoid Valve (LV1, L96, or LC8) Q12 Evaporative Emission Purge Solenoid Valve (L96/LC8)
4. B68B Knock Sensor 2 B68B Knock Sensor 2 (L96/LC8)
5. B34 Engine Coolant Temperature Sensor B34 Engine Coolant Temperature Sensor (LC8/L96)
6. B23 Camshaft Position Sensor B23 Camshaft Position Sensor (L96/LC8)
7. G13 Generator G13 Generator X1 (L96/LC8)G13 Generator X2 (LC8/(L96+K68))
